Oklahoma FreeWheel seminars


FreeWheel is Oklahoma's annual cross-state bicycle tour. The 2010 edition will take place from June 13 to June 19.

This year's series of "Get Ready” cycling seminars are presented by Tom’s Bicycles and FreeWheel Inc. The seminars are open to all interested cyclists, not just FreeWheel participants. Please watch for new information at the Oklahoma FreeWheel site. What follows is a preliminary schedule, so times and places are subject to change.

The seminars will meet in Tulsa at the OSU College of Osteopathic Medicine, Health Sciences Center at 1111 West 17th Street (17th and Southwest Boulevard to some) in Room D-007 from 7:00 to 9:00pm . Parking is available behind the building. Security can direct you to the auditorium.

Additionally, the Tulsa Bicycle Club meetings include speakers on a variety of bicycling topics, including FreeWheel. In the spring, TBC has a series of rides with increasing distances each week, in an effort to prepare riders for the cross-state event. The schedule for those rides will be posted here when it becomes available.

Tuesday, Jan 19th

"Announce The Route Already!"

Ellen Proctor, FreeWheel '10 Director, announces the route for this year's ride on this night, including a town-by-town description, routes, and features along the way.

"Get Me Ready"

Joy Hancock, Fitness/Volunteer/Communications Coordinator at the Youth and Family Center, will cover off-the-bike training and winter exercise as a foundation of the 2010 cycling season.


Tuesday, Feb 9th

"Get The Bike Ready!"

Tom Brown, owner of Tom's Bicycles, will speak about proper bike selection, efficient riding, and simple maintenance.

Thursday Feb 19th

"Get Moving Already!"

Dr. Susan Payne, head of the Sport Management Department at Rogers State University, will cover training for both speed and endurance riding. She is a nine year veteran of a FreeWheel.

Tuesday March 9

"Get Moving Already!"

Richard Hall, FreeWheel veteran, 2009 President of the Oklahoma Bicycling Coalition, and League of American Bicyclists certified Cycling instructor, will cover road riding techniques and etiquette. He'll tell riders what to watch for, where to ride, and relates several FreeWheel issues. He has some great photos of previous FreeWheel tours.

Thursday March 18

"Enough Already!"

In this final seminar, Ellen Proctor and the FreeWheel staff will cover what to expect and what to look forward to during the tour. Late breaking news and information will be provided in this seminar, including detailed route, town, and transportation info.
